您当前的位置: 牛津答题 > 知识库 > 计算机编程基本术语是什么
计算机编程基本术语是什么
发布时间:2024-02-12 18:05

计算机编程基本术语

1. 编程语言

编程语言是用来定义计算机程序的语言。它是一种符号系统,用来表达我们想要计算机执行的任务。编程语言有很多种类,包括低级语言(如C和Assembly)和高级语言(如Pyho和Java)。

2. 变量与数据类型

变量是用来存储数据的一种方式。数据类型则是指变量的类型,例如整数(i)、浮点数(floa)、字符串(srig)等。在编程中,我们需要声明变量的类型,以便在程序中使用它们。

3. 运算符与表达式

运算符是用来操作变量和值的符号。例如,加法( )、减法(-)、乘法()和除法(/)等。表达式则是由变量、运算符和值组成的计算式。例如,3 4 2 = 11。

4. 程序控制结构

程序控制结构是用来控制程序执行流程的结构。它们包括顺序结构(按照代码的顺序执行)、选择结构(如if-else语句,用于根据条件执行不同的代码块)和循环结构(如for和while循环,用于重复执行代码块)。

5. 函数与模块

函数是一段可重用的代码块,用于执行特定任务。模块则是一个包含函数和其他代码的文件。通过使用函数和模块,我们可以将代码分解成更小的部分,使其更易于理解和维护。

6. 面向对象编程

面向对象编程是一种编程范式,它将程序看作是由对象组成的。对象是具有属性和行为的实体。面向对象编程包括类和对象的概念,类是对象的模板,而对象是类的实例。面向对象编程还包括继承、封装和多态等概念。

7. 异常处理与调试

异常处理是处理程序中出现的错误的方式。当程序出现错误时,会抛出一个异常。调试则是查找和修复程序中的错误的过程。在编程中,我们需要学会如何处理异常和进行调试。

8. 软件测试与质量保证

软件测试是在软件开发过程中对软件进行质量保证的一种方式。它包括单元测试、集成测试、系统测试和验收测试等。质量保证则是确保软件质量的过程,它包括代码审查、文档编写、配置管理和版本控制等。

9. 版本控制与代码审查

版本控制是一种管理系统,用于跟踪和管理代码的更改。它可以帮助我们在多人协作开发中避免代码冲突。代码审查是一种检查代码质量的过程,它可以帮助我们发现错误和改善代码质量。